First Ever BCHL Affiliate Draft

Township of Langley, BC, Tuesday October 3rd, 2011 :  On Monday October 3rd, the BCHL held its first ever Affiliate Draft , which gave teams a chance to select fifteen year old players for the purpose of Affiliation during the 2011-2012 BCHL season. The draft contained two rounds in which each team had the opportunity to select one player per round (picks were not mandatory as the draft itself was optional).  The Langley Rivermen held the 10th and 26th picks of the draft and used those selections for the following two players:

 

Ryan Simpson , Forward,  10th overall:  At 6’2”, 180 pounds, Ryan is a centre from Abbotsford, BC and plays for the Fraser Valley Bruins of the BC Major Midget League. 

Rivermen Assistant Coach Jordan Emmerson like what he has seen from Ryan, “he is a big forward that skates well and is an overall good athlete; he is also a great kid who has good offensive ability and a bright future ahead”. So far this season in Abbotsford, Ryan has played in four games for the Bruins and has eight penalty minutes.

 

Dalton Yorke, Defense, 26th overall– At 6’0”, 175 pounds, Dalton is a defensemen from Maple Ridge, BC and plays for the Vancouver North East Chiefs of the BC Major Midget League. 

“Dalton is a great kid and a steady defensemen who has good Hockey sense to go along with it," Assistant Coach, and former BCHL defenseman, Bobby Henderson has become a big fan of Dalton's ability, "we will continue to develop him and look to in the near future”.

Yorke has picked up two assists in two games for the Chiefs so far this season.

Both Yorke and Simpson should have the chance to earn their spot for next year at some point this season.
